2. Data we process

Vehicle registration lookups

When you run a check, the extension processes the UK registration mark (VRM) you enter, select, or confirm from a listing page. Related MOT expiry, tax status, and summary vehicle attributes returned by the lookup may also be processed so AffixIO can issue circuit proofs.

Website content on matched listing sites

On supported vehicle listing and GOV.UK pages, a content script may read visible page text only to detect UK registration marks and show an optional Plate Pass chip. That detection runs locally in your browser. A registration is sent to AffixIO only when you start a check.

Local extension storage

The extension stores on your device:

  • Settings (detection toggles, optional AffixIO API base URL, optional API key)
  • Recent check history (VRM, MOT and tax summary, AffixIO proof identifiers and digests)

You can clear recent checks from the extension popup.

Optional AffixIO API key

If you paste an AffixIO API key in Options, it is stored in Chrome sync or local storage on your devices and sent only to api.affix-io.com (or the API base you configure) when proving circuits. Leave the key blank to use the AffixIO Plate Pass proxy instead.

3. How we use data

Data is used only to:

  • Perform the MOT and tax road-legal lookup you requested
  • Issue AffixIO proofs on circuits such as motor_inspection_valid, attested_range, and audit_proof
  • Show results and recent checks inside the extension
  • Operate, secure, and rate-limit AffixIO services that back those requests

We do not sell Plate Pass user data. We do not use it to determine creditworthiness or for lending. We do not use it for unrelated advertising profiles.

4. Where data is sent

Network calls for Plate Pass go to AffixIO hosts:

Lookups may consult official or open vehicle data sources (for example DVLA or GOV.UK-backed records) through AffixIO’s Plate Pass backend so the extension can return live MOT and tax status. AffixIO’s verification design aims for binary eligibility outcomes and proof metadata rather than retaining personal identity dossiers on the default verify path.

6. Retention

  • On your device: settings and recent checks remain until you clear them, uninstall the extension, or Chrome clears extension storage.
  • On AffixIO: proof metadata and operational logs may be retained as needed to operate attestation, Merkle audit, security, and rate limiting. AffixIO is built so the default verify path is designed not to retain personal source records. See Compliance.

7. Security

Transport uses HTTPS. Optional API keys should be treated as secrets. Prefer AffixIO hub keys with least privilege. Production AffixIO attestation uses ML-DSA-65. Report security issues via Security or hello@affix-io.com.
